Optical Properties
Refractive Index (nd) 1.670737
Abbe Number (Vd) 52.593907
Dispersion Formula Handbook of Optics 1
Wavelength Range 0.22 — 1.06 µm
$$n(\lambda) = \sqrt{2.7405 + \frac{0.0184}{\lambda^2 - 0.0179} - 0.0155\,\lambda^2}$$
